Valencia Basket began its
fifth participation in the Turkish Airlines Euroleague having defeated all its
rivals of this season at least once except three. Two of them because they had
never played each other in the top continental competition. But the triumphs on
round 8 vs. FC Bayern Munich and on round 9 vs. Zenit St.Petersburg mean that
the taronja team has only one team left to lay down at least once all the rest
of 2019-20 Turkish Airlines Euroleague competitors. And it is precisely its
rival next Thursday at 7:00 p.m. at Aleksandar Nikolic Hall, Crvena Zvevda MTS
Belgrade, with which the taronja squad has a 0-4 Euroleague balance. Will the
last survivor fall finally in the Pionir Hall?
